chatgpt知识库怎么搭建

要搭建一个ChatGPT知识库,可以按照以下步骤进行:

  1. 数据收集:收集与你的知识库主题相关的数据。这可以包括文本数据、文章、网页内容、电子书等等。确保数据内容准确、全面,并且与用户可能提出的问题相关。
  2. 数据预处理:对收集到的数据进行预处理,以清理和准备数据。这可能包括去除特殊字符、标点符号、停用词,进行分词和标记等。
  3. 数据建模:使用自然语言处理(NLP)技术,例如词袋模型、词嵌入等,将数据转换为机器可理解的形式。这将有助于算法理解语义和上下文。
  4. 训练模型:使用机器学习算法,例如神经网络,训练一个ChatGPT模型。可以使用开源框架,如TensorFlow或PyTorch,来实现模型训练。确保将训练数据划分为训练集、验证集和测试集,以便在训练过程中进行评估和调优。
  5. 模型评估:评估训练后的模型性能。可以使用一些指标,如准确率、召回率、F1分数等来评估模型的性能。如果模型表现不佳,则需要重新调整数据和模型架构。
  6. 部署模型:将训练好的ChatGPT模型部署到一个可用的平台上,以便用户可以通过提问问题与它进行交互。这可以是一个网页应用程序、聊天机器人或其他类型的用户界面。
  7. 持续改进:根据用户的反馈和使用情况,不断改进和优化ChatGPT模型。可以通过监控用户反馈、评估模型表现、收集用户需求等方式来改进模型的性能。

以上是一个基本的搭建ChatGPT知识库的流程,具体的实施步骤可能因应用场景和需求的不同而有所差异。

要搭建ChatGPT知识库,可以按照以下步骤进行操作:

  1. 收集数据:收集与你想要构建知识库相关的数据。这可以包括文本文件、网页、数据库、论文或其他来源。
  2. 数据预处理:对收集到的数据进行预处理。这可能包括清洗数据、去除噪音、标准化格式等。确保数据的一致性和可读性。
  3. 构建知识库:将预处理后的数据导入到适当的数据库或知识图谱中。选择适合你需求的技术工具,如MySQL、MongoDB、Neo4j等。
  4. 设计知识库结构:根据你的需求,设计知识库的结构。这可能包括建立实体关系模型、定义属性、创建索引等。
  5. 实体链接:根据知识库的结构,将输入的问题与知识库中的实体进行匹配。这可以通过实体链接技术实现,如使用命名实体识别(NER)和实体消歧(EL)等。
  6. 检索与推荐:根据输入的问题,从知识库中检索相关的信息,并根据需要进行推荐。这可以使用搜索引擎技术、向量化模型、推荐系统等。
  7. 模型集成:将ChatGPT与知识库进行集成,以实现对知识库的查询和回答。可以使用API或其他方法将ChatGPT与知识库连接起来。
  8. 测试和优化:对知识库和ChatGPT进行测试和优化。检查系统的性能、准确性和可靠性,并根据需要进行改进。

以上是一个基本的搭建知识库的流程,具体的实施步骤可能根据你的需求和技术环境而有所不同。

chatgpt知识库怎么搭建 发布者:luotuoemo,转转请注明出处:https://www.chatairc.com/10407/

(0)
luotuoemo's avatarluotuoemo
上一篇 2023年8月2日 上午3:20
下一篇 2023年8月2日 上午3:42

相关推荐

  • gpt4.0概念

    GPT-4.0(Generative Pre-trained Transformer 4.0)是一种基于自然语言处理的人工智能模型,由OpenAI开发。它是GPT系列的第四个版本,旨在进一步提升语言生成和理解的能力。 GPT-4.0是一个预训练模型,意味着它通过在庞大的文本语料库上进行训练,学习语言的概念、语法和语义。与传统的机器学习模型不同,GPT-4.0…

    2023年11月30日
    71500
  • new bing ai怎么用

    要使用新的Bing AI,您可以遵循以下步骤: 打开Bing的官方网站或下载Bing的手机应用程序。 在搜索栏中输入您感兴趣的问题、主题或关键词。 在搜索结果页面上,您会看到新的Bing AI在搜索结果中显示的信息。它可能会提供与您查询相关的即时答案、相关文章、图像或视频等。 点击或滑动以查看更多相关信息。 如果您有特定需求或问题,可以尝试在搜索栏中提问,B…

    2023年12月11日
    79900
  • CHATGPT如何进行智能语音助手开发优化?

    要进行智能语音助手的开发优化,可以考虑以下几个方面: 数据集和训练策略:使用大规模的数据集来训练模型,包括语音和文本数据。优化数据集的质量和多样性,确保模型可以处理不同的语音输入和用户查询。采用合适的训练策略,如迭代训练、增量学习等,以提高模型的性能和适应能力。 语音识别技术:采用高质量的语音识别技术,可以减少误识别率,并提高语音输入的准确性。可以使用端到端…

    2023年6月29日
    64900
  • openai和chatgpt

    OpenAI 是一家人工智能(AI)研究实验室,开发了许多领先的自然语言处理模型,包括GPT-3(Generative Pre-trained Transformer 3)。这些模型可以生成自然语言文本,并在问答、对话和文本生成等方面展现出卓越的能力。 ChatGPT 是 OpenAI 开发的一个用于对话交互的模型,它是建立在GPT-3的基础上。ChatGP…

    2023年11月17日
    65600
  • chatgpt辅助开发

    当使用ChatGPT进行开发时,有几个方面可以考虑来提高开发效率和优化模型的性能: 数据收集和准备:收集和准备用于训练和评估模型的数据。确保数据具有足够的多样性和覆盖范围,以便模型能够处理各种不同的输入和请求。 模型训练和微调:使用适当的训练数据和超参数来训练ChatGPT模型。可以使用预训练模型进行微调,以便更好地适应特定的任务或领域。可能需要进行多次训练…

    2023年8月5日
    65200

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:582059487@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
国内Chat Ai版本直接使用:https://chat.chatairc.com/